1. High-Fidelity BIM & Spatial Coordination inside Autodesk Revit
Traditional flat drawings are notorious for hiding physical "clashes" that are only caught when installation teams try to hang physical equipment in the field. We transform standard 2D schematic blueprints into high-fidelity, intelligent 3D digital assets completely inside Autodesk Revit.
By mapping multi-layered spatial pathways, structured cabling lines, security/CCTV arrays, and heavy data center nodes directly into the core architectural workspace, we perform rigorous Clash Detection before a single physical component is ordered.

3. Modular, Structured & Compliance-Driven Technical Documentation
A digital asset is only as valuable as the documentation that accompanies it. For verified As-Builts, precision shop drawings, and enterprise operations manuals, we abandon loose word processing and implement semantic, structured data structures:
DITA XML (PTC Arbortext / Oxygen XML): Breaking documentation into granular, reusable topic modules for massive component reuse and cross-platform publishing.
DocBook XML: Enforcing deep structural validation for system-level equipment specifications and reference guides.
LaTeX / pdfLaTeX Document Preparation: Engineering clean, typographically flawless technical manuals and math-dense engineering files.
Markdown Ecosystems: Writing agile, human-readable documentation built to feed effortlessly into developer portals or Git-backed repositories.
4. PECE Professional Services: Compliance Grounded in Law
Every robust electronics plan must have legal and structural authority before break-ground. Under the direct supervision of a licensed Professional Electronics Engineer (PECE), we handle the critical reviewing, signing off, and official sealing of comprehensive electronics plans. This guarantees absolute alignment with local government permitting units, the Philippine Electronics Code (PEC), and strict building authority documentation requirements, completely clearing up administrative or permitting bottlenecks.
